On average across the year,
yes, Iraq is hotter than
Wayne, New Jersey
.
Iraq has an average temperature of 27°C/81°F and Wayne, New Jersey has an average temperature of 13°C/55°F.
Iraq's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 47°C/117°F, which is hotter than Wayne, New Jersey's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, no, Iraq is not colder than Wayne, New Jersey . Iraq has an average minimum temperature of 20°C/68°F and Wayne, New Jersey has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Iraq has less rain than
Wayne, New Jersey. Iraq has an average annual rainfall of 95mm and Wayne, New Jersey has an average annual rainfall of 1513mm.
Iraq's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 21mm, which is drier than Wayne, New Jersey's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 161mm).
